9 references to ConfigurationServiceEndpointProviderOptions
Microsoft.Extensions.ServiceDiscovery (7)
Configuration\ConfigurationServiceEndpointProvider.cs (2)
24
private readonly IOptions<
ConfigurationServiceEndpointProviderOptions
> _options;
38
IOptions<
ConfigurationServiceEndpointProviderOptions
> options,
Configuration\ConfigurationServiceEndpointProviderFactory.cs (1)
16
IOptions<
ConfigurationServiceEndpointProviderOptions
> options,
Configuration\ConfigurationServiceEndpointProviderOptionsValidator.cs (2)
8
internal sealed class ConfigurationServiceEndpointProviderOptionsValidator : IValidateOptions<
ConfigurationServiceEndpointProviderOptions
>
10
public ValidateOptionsResult Validate(string? name,
ConfigurationServiceEndpointProviderOptions
options)
ServiceDiscoveryServiceCollectionExtensions.cs (2)
90
public static IServiceCollection AddConfigurationServiceEndpointProvider(this IServiceCollection services, Action<
ConfigurationServiceEndpointProviderOptions
> configureOptions)
97
services.AddTransient<IValidateOptions<
ConfigurationServiceEndpointProviderOptions
>, ConfigurationServiceEndpointProviderOptionsValidator>();
Microsoft.Extensions.ServiceDiscovery.Tests (2)
ExtensionsServicePublicApiTests.cs (2)
115
Action<
ConfigurationServiceEndpointProviderOptions
> configureOptions = (_) => { };
127
Action<
ConfigurationServiceEndpointProviderOptions
> configureOptions = null!;